Metro station
The is located on the Yellow Line of the Delhi Metro. The station is located near the headquarters of IFFCO, PowerGrid Corporation of India and RITES Limited. It is also in the vicinity of Essel Towers and Westin Hotel, Gurugram. is situated 4 km east of Sheetla Colony-Block A.
